Primary Objective/Purpose of the Job 

Reporting to the Senior Business Development Manager, the Business Development Manager is expected to deliver individual new-to-business sales volume and revenue targets whilst ensuring assigned deliverables and new solution implementation objectives are met.

Responsibilities

  • Work with management team to formulate, plan and execute new sales strategies

  •  Understand and deliver against assigned individual annual target

  • Aggressively negotiate for the most competitive but sustainable pricing for the business

  • Identify and own all new sales activities from opportunities to conversion while ensuring compliance with internal policies and procedures for optimal merchant sales and services delivery.

  • Actively monitor market trends and activities. Understand and recommend new products or solutions to address evolving needs of merchants.

  • Collaborate across teams to improve merchant service and satisfaction level.

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
